Sheet for covering cylindrical containers
The cylindrical container covering sheet addresses the lack of functionality in existing sheets by incorporating customizable features for information display and emergency preparedness, enhancing usability and emergency readiness.

Technical Field
[0001] The present invention relates to a cylindrical container covering sheet that can be wound around a cylindrical container such as a can or a bottle to cover the container.
Background Art
[0002] A sheet is wound around the body of a cylindrical container such as a can or a bottle. The applicant has grasped Patent Document 1 below as prior art literature regarding such a winding sheet.
Prior Art Document
Patent Document
[0003]
Patent Document 1
[0004] The above patent document relates to a dew condensation prevention cover for a drinking container and has the following description.
[0013] [Example 1] A water-absorbing sheet 1 made of a highly water-absorbent non-woven fiber having a dimension 10 mm shorter than the outer peripheral length of a beer bottle 5 was continuously bonded with a 16-μm-thick polyethylene terephthalate film (hereinafter referred to as a PET film) 30 mm wider than the size of the water-absorbing sheet 1 using an adhesive. Then, it was cut perpendicular to the continuous direction according to the size of the portion where dew condensation prevention of the beer bottle 5 was desired, and a dew condensation prevention cover for a drinking container having a sticking margin portion 3 as shown in the first figure was created.
[0014] Next, as shown in Figures 2 and 3, the drinking container condensation prevention cover is wrapped around the beer bottle 5, the inside of the adhesive portion 3 of the PET film 2 is moistened with water 6, and when it is attached to the surface of the lower PET film 2, the PET film is temporarily fixed in place by the surface tension of the water 6. As a result, the drinking container condensation prevention cover absorbs the water droplets that condense on the cold beer due to the relatively high temperature of the outside air, and the drinking container condensation prevention cover is fixed around the beer bottle 5, making it easier to handle. In addition, the water-absorbing sheet 1 absorbs water appropriately, providing a non-slip surface, and the beer bottle 5 inside does not fall out. [Overview of the Initiative] [Problems that the invention aims to solve]
[0005] In the technology described in Patent Document 1, a PET film 2 wrapped around the body of a can or bottle is provided with an adhesive portion 3. When the drinking container condensation prevention cover is wrapped around a beer bottle 5, the inside of the adhesive portion 3 is wet with water 6, and it is attached to the surface of the lower PET film 2, and the PET film is temporarily fixed in place by the surface tension of the water 6.
[0006] The above technology does not include the idea of providing a part of the sheet that is wrapped around a container such as a beer bottle with a function other than wrapping.
[0007] On the other hand, there is a need for sheets that are wrapped around the body of cylindrical containers such as cans and bottles to have functions such as displaying useful information.
[0008] This invention was made with the following objectives in order to solve the above-mentioned problems. The present invention provides a cylindrical container covering sheet that can be wrapped around the body of a cylindrical container such as a can or bottle, on which desired information can be printed, and which can then be detached from the cylindrical container for use. Modes for Carrying Out the Invention
[0022] Hereinafter, embodiments of the present invention will be described in detail.
[0023] Figure 1 is a diagram illustrating a cylindrical container covering sheet according to an embodiment of the present invention.
[0024] The cylindrical container covering sheet of this embodiment has a sheet body 10 that has a vertical dimension Y and a horizontal dimension X.
[0025] In this embodiment, the cylindrical container 20 is illustrated in the figure as a can. In this example, the cylindrical portion of the can, excluding the upper and lower seams 22, is the body 21. This example describes the case where the can is canned emergency food. Therefore, in this example, the cylindrical container 20 is stockpiled at home or in the office in preparation for disasters, with the premise that it will be carried to an evacuation center or similar location when a disaster occurs.
[0026] [Sheet body 10] The sheet body 10 can be made of paper, plastic film, or the like.
[0027] The vertical dimension Y is set to a dimension corresponding to the vertical dimension of the body portion 21 of the cylindrical container 20 to be covered. Here, the dimension corresponding to the vertical dimension of the body portion 21 means that the vertical dimension Y is not necessarily exactly equal to the vertical dimension of the body portion 21, but rather allows for some degree of dimensional difference. Preferably, the vertical dimension Y is set to a dimension equal to or slightly smaller than the vertical dimension of the body portion 21.
[0028] The above horizontal dimension X is set to the sum of the dimension X1 corresponding to the outer circumference of the body portion 21 of the cylindrical container 20 and the additional dimension X2. Here, the dimension X1 corresponding to the outer circumference of the body portion 21 is not limited to being exactly equal to the outer circumference of the body portion 21, but is intended to allow for some degree of dimensional difference. Preferably, the above dimension X1 is set to be equal to or slightly larger than the outer circumference of the body portion 21. The above additional dimension X2 can be set to any desired dimension.
[0029] The sheet body 10 is provided with a perforation line 11 at a distance of X1 corresponding to the outer circumference of the body 21 of the cylindrical container 20, extending from one end (the left end in Figure 1) to the other end (the right end in Figure 1) in the horizontal direction. The perforation line 11 is not particularly limited, but preferably, a perforation line can be used, which is made by making fine cuts (pitch) in the sheet body 10 so that it can be easily separated by hand.
[0030] Furthermore, the end of the cylindrical container 20 that is wrapped around the body 21 of the cylindrical container 20 and covers the body 21 is the covering portion 31. The other end of the cylindrical container 20 that is wrapped around the body 21 is the information display portion 41 on which predetermined information is displayed.
[0031] [Covered portion 31] As shown in Figure 2, the covering portion 31 can be wrapped around the outer circumference of the body portion 21 of the cylindrical container 20 to cover the body portion 21. In this example, the dimension X1 is set to be slightly larger than the outer circumference of the body portion 21. Therefore, when the covering portion 31 is wrapped around the outer circumference of the body portion 21 of the cylindrical container 20 to cover the body portion 21, an excess portion 39 is formed where both ends of the covering portion 31 overlap. In this state, the information portion 41 can be cut off from the cut line 11. With the information portion 41 cut off, both ends of the covering portion 31 can be secured with adhesive tape or the like to maintain the covering state of the body portion 21.
[0032] As shown in Figure 3, the surface of the covering portion 31 is provided with a pattern display section 33 on a substantially white background. The substantially white background is not limited to pure white, but includes light colors such as light ivory, light gray, and milky white, as long as they do not interfere with the coloring process described later.
[0033] The image displayed in the image display section 33 is a coloring page in which the area enclosed by the outline is a colored area where the white background is exposed. In this embodiment, the image represents the supplies needed in the event of a disaster, and the image display section 33 functions as a list of items to prepare for a disaster.
[0034] Furthermore, a two-dimensional code 35 is displayed on the surface of the covering portion 31. The two-dimensional code 35 can, for example, contain a link to a webpage containing desired information. This allows us to provide users with a large amount of information that cannot be displayed on the sheet body 10. The information to be posted on the webpage could, for example, be a checklist of items needed in the event of a disaster.
[0035] Furthermore, a name printing space 37 is provided on the surface of the covering portion 31. This name printing space 37 is essentially a blank space where a company name, logo, contact address, contact phone number, website URL, etc., can be printed or engraved as needed. Such a name printing space 37 can be effectively utilized when the cylindrical container 20 (in this example, canned emergency food) is offered as a novelty item. In other words, the provider of the novelty item can print or engrave their company name, etc., on it.
[0036] As shown in Figure 4, the back surface of the covering portion 31 is provided with a first entry field 34 where the assembly place in the event of a disaster can be written. The first entry field 34 has space to write up to three assembly places in the event of a disaster. By writing the destination in the event of a disaster in the first entry field 34, it is possible to evacuate quickly and without getting lost when taking this cylindrical container 20 with you.
[0037] Furthermore, a second entry field 36 is provided on the back of the covering portion 31 for writing emergency contact information. The second entry field 36 has space to write up to three emergency contact numbers in case of disaster. By writing emergency contact information in the second entry field 36, when evacuating with this cylindrical container 20, you can be sure to make contact without worrying about not knowing who the necessary emergency contacts are.
[0038] By wrapping the covering portion 31 around the cylindrical container 20 to cover the body portion 21, it can be used to create a list of necessary disaster prevention supplies when stockpiling the cylindrical container 20 (in this example, canned emergency food). Furthermore, when evacuating with the cylindrical container 20 (in this example, canned emergency food) during a disaster, one can evacuate quickly and without hesitation, and contact emergency contacts without fail.
[0039] [Information section 41] The information display portion 41 described above is detached from the cylindrical container 20 to which the covering portion 31 is wrapped, and the detached information display portion 41 can be used by storing the displayed information separately from the cylindrical container 20. For example, the information display portion 41 can display the name and contact information of the company that sells the cylindrical container 20 (in this example, canned emergency food).
